I’m having an issue where on my passenger side the inner trim piece at the top of the a pillar is pulling back and down. I had not done any adjustments to any of the trim pieces or their attachment points with the exception of trying to slightly loosen and tighten the bolts attaching it to see if that fixes the problem. Anybody had this happen and found a fix?
